Mastering Data Structures & Algorithms For Software Engineering Interviews

 thumbnail

Mastering Data Structures & Algorithms For Software Engineering Interviews

Published Mar 04, 25
7 min read
[=headercontent]Top 10 System Design Interview Questions Asked At Faang [/headercontent] [=image]
Mastering The Software Engineering Interview – Tips From Faang Recruiters

How To Handle Multiple Faang Job Offers – Tips For Candidates




[/video]

the list takes place. Completion objective is to have one generic duplicate of your return to prepared which has actually been prepared such that it demonstrates every one of your abilities, and various other people can see that. You can currently modify this according to the company you are relating to and the qualifications that they are seeking.

How To Prepare For Amazon’s Software Development Engineer Interview

Best Leetcode Problems To Practice For Faang Interviews


The benefit of making use of LeetCode, whether you like it or despise it, is that it has formats of concerns most often used by tech business in coding rounds. The method is to construct a skill that can help you translate - given this problem, what are the algorithms in my "toolbox" that I can utilize to address this issue.

If I had to offer you my very own example, I have not also touched 200 questions on LeetCode myself and I believe I did rather well in my interviews. The various other source that people like to make use of is Fracturing the Coding Interview. I have that publication, I assume it is great, I simply have actually never had the ability to utilize it myself.

Actual meetings will have at the very least one even more individual, if not more and it is important that you have actually exercised offering the interview to one various other individual (and not just your screen). Technical Interviews are not just about creating the excellent code and making certain it puts together, you will certainly also have to discuss your idea procedure and why you are doing what you are doing.

Sometimes if you are lacking time and can not complete the code, yet can discuss what your objectives are, you could still escape and clear that round. I will return to the very same point that I stated is essential for your resume: feedback. We are all frightened of failure and letting somebody else understand what our flaws are, however better a friend/peer than than the interviewer.

Amazon Software Developer Interview – Most Common Questions

It will certainly assist me make content far better fit to the demands of individuals checking out. If you have certain inquiries concerning any kind of part of the process, drop them below also!.

This is still indicated to be a useful, not theoretical, conversation. Draw from your previous experience and usage precise instances to describe what you would certainly do and why. And like all of our meeting concerns, it will be designed to "ladder," meaning your job interviewer's follow-ups can obtain moreor lesschallenging as you advance.

This belongs to how we analyze finding out agility; we desire to understand just how well you assume on your feet. In the manager interview, we'll speak about who you are todayand who you want to go to Atlassian. Naturally, throughout the meeting procedure, we intend to make certain we get to know prospects as humansand we desire them to learn more about us.

In this sessionusually one-on-one with either the hiring manager or an extra elderly supervisor on the teamwe'll ask inquiries developed to comprehend not simply that you are, yet additionally what you're interested in and delighted about. We'll speak about how you can add value not just in the duty and group you're getting, yet in your long-lasting career at Atlassian.

We'll also utilize this session to learn as long as we can about exactly how you work, especially your partnership and interaction designs. Make sure you're prepared to talk concerning a past project or 2, from who you worked with to the technological obstacles you needed to get over. You can likewise talk to the company reason for the projectthe factor you were working with it to begin with.

Why Faang Companies Focus On Problem-solving Skills In Interviews

Interaction and partnership are vital abilities on our group, so simply assume of it as one more opportunity to reveal your things. The worths interview is created to examine your positioning withand address your concerns aboutAtlassian's 5 values.

The last modifications as we grow, and varies from office to workplace. Our worths remain the very same. They're the backbone on which a sustainable firm is developed. And since our worths are woven into our techniques, processes, and the way we run our groups, your worths job interviewer likely won't be a member of the group you're putting on sign up with; it could be somebody from Sales, HR, or Client Assistance. Tips for Acing a Technical Software Engineering Interview.

The Best Courses To Prepare For A Microsoft Software Engineering Interview

What’s A Faang Software Engineer’s Salary & How To Get There?


Our goal is to comprehend your way of thinking, and the method it overviews your activities. After effectively completing the interview process, your recruiters will certainly settle feedback and debrief. If there's an excellent fit in between your skills and experience, you will progress to the last while doing so - being assessed by a Hiring Board.

How To Prepare For A Technical Software Engineer Interview – Best Practices

Atlassian employing committee participants are different from the job interviewers you will certainly fulfill and just have accessibility to specific info connecting to the interview process (this consists of interview comments and curriculum vitae details). The employing board will look holistically at abilities, staminas and behaviors, making sure an objective employing decision. As you go through this procedure, we want you to have a great experience - and we wish to do every little thing we can to bring out the very best in you, due to the fact that it's your finest that will certainly identify exactly how you can add to our team.

Preparing For Your Full Loop Interview At Meta – What To Expect

Senior Software Engineer Interview Study Plan – A Complete Guide


If you don't recognize what to do, say so! Interaction and partnership are key abilities on our group, so just believe of it as an additional chance to show your stuff. Essential, know that we're not hiring with one ideal prospect in mind. Rather, we're generating individuals with a variety of skills, backgrounds, and perspectives, and providing every possible possibility to place their ideal foot onward.

The Complete Guide To Software Engineering Interview Preparation

Created by OpenAI, ChatGPT is an exceptional device that can change your meeting preparation experience. With its comprehensive knowledge and conversational capabilities, ChatGPT becomes your relied on companion, supplying useful guidance, insights, and support throughout your trip.

This blog site aims to direct software application designers on how to take advantage of ChatGPT successfully for meeting preparation. From gathering meeting details to practicing technical concerns and boosting soft abilities, this blog will help you take advantage of ChatGPT as a useful source. By the end of this blog site, you will have a clear understanding of just how to successfully use ChatGPT to enhance your possibilities of success in software application designer interviews.

The Best Courses To Prepare For A Microsoft Software Engineering Interview

These interviews assess your ability to develop scalable and efficient software application systems. You might be asked to describe the style, components, and scalability factors to consider for an offered situation.

It has the potential to be a helpful resource for software application programmers that are planning for meetings. ChatGPT can help in preparing meeting concerns, practicing technological problems, and enhancing soft skills to its substantial understanding base and capability to create pertinent and informative responses. ChatGPT can be a wonderful resource for meeting preparation, supplying many possibilities to improve your readiness.

ChatGPT functions as your digital recruiter, offering you an immersive prep work experience with its interactive and vibrant conversational capacities. "I'm presently planning for a job interview in (Work Title). Could you please play the role of job interviewer and ask me some questions? Please ask me (Variety of Questions) concerns, one at a time:"Use ChatGPT to Practice Mock Interview "As a (Your Duty) prospect, I am currently preparing for this setting.

Could you please produce interview concerns connected to these ideas to help me practice?" Have a look at this real-time ChatGPT conversation: If you expect meeting questions however do not have the responses, ChatGPT can be a useful source. It can create actions to help you understand and prepare for those questions, providing important understandings to aid you improve your knowledge and preparedness.